When we stayed at the cabins we took some camp chairs to put on the deck outside for comfort. The only seating on the deck is the picnic table. Nice for eating, but not for lounging!!

Food, snacks and drinks. The rest you can make happen in the kitchen with what they provide. I remember seeing a complete list of what is in the cabins at disney. You could either google it or maybe someone can remember where it is around here. I am new around here, but love it already! :banana:

When I was there a few yrs ago there was a DVD player in the living room so take a few movies maybe.

Last but not least, not all agree, but to me renting a golf cart is most necessary. We enjoyed carting around the whole grounds at night seeing all the camp sites. WOW, awesome! Carting all over just for siteseeing. It just seems inconvenient to me to have to bus to the sites or walk. The grounds are pretty large and the golf cart just makes the experience.....well....an experience!! :thumbsup2
